微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

css clear 案例

CSS中的 clear 属性可以用于清除浮动。当一个元素浮动时,它会脱离文档流,造成周围的元素受影响,尤其是父元素。为了解决这个问题,我们可以在浮动元素下方添加一个空元素,并给它设置 clear 属性

.clearfix:before,.clearfix:after {
    content: " ";
    display: table;
}
.clearfix:after {
    clear: both;
}
.clearfix {
    *zoom: 1;
}

css clear 案例

上述代码一个使用了 clear 属性的案例。在 .clearfix 类中,使用了伪元素 :before 和 :after 创建了两个空元素,并分别设置为 table 和 clear:both。通过这种方式,这两个元素可以将浮动元素下方的内容顺利清除,使得页面效果更加美观。

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 [email protected] 举报,一经查实,本站将立刻删除。